Transaction 3f7058ffcfffddc31a103e2e7985d75251404e592fb4c220d90d1d83ae77bd99
1 Input
2 Outputs
- 3f7058ffcfffddc31a103e2e7985d75251404e592fb4c220d90d1d83ae77bd99:0
- 3f7058ffcfffddc31a103e2e7985d75251404e592fb4c220d90d1d83ae77bd99:1
value 13145000
address 1GpHPvCrYVeCbYHvwvVxPZWKZ6KoY6p6fp
value 1981531669
address 1XpM4wMRCNKdAhCwQ9WSzG6MUCjqkstUW